AI-Summary

What this Trial Is About

Every year, millions of children are diagnosed with neurodevelopmental disabilities. This term covers a wide range of conditions, from genetic syndromes to brain injuries such as cerebral palsy. Children with neurodevelopmental disabilities often struggle in multiple areas, including language development. While standard speech therapy mainly focuses on understanding and producing words, these children may also have difficulties with the social and communicative skills needed for language. The parent-child relationship is especially important for helping kids develop in their early years. This clinical trial aims to find out if an intervention focused on early social and communication skills, and involving parents, can help children with neurodevelopmental disabilities. The study includes children aged 6 months to 5 years. It seeks to answer two key questions: * Does this intervention improve social and communication skills better than standard speech therapy? * Does this intervention affect how parents interact with their child? To find the answers, the study will compare two groups: one group will get the parent-involved intervention that focuses on early communication skills, while the other group will get standard speech therapy. In the first intervention, therapists will guide parents in observing and supporting their child's social and communication behaviors during various activities like playtime and snack time. In contrast, the standard speech therapy will focus on traditional goals, such as improving the child's ability to vocalize, understand, and use words, without involving parents. Both interventions will follow the same schedule-eight weekly sessions, each lasting 45 minutes, over two months. Before and after the interventions, the children and parents will: * Have an assessment of the child's language, social, and communication development. * Participate in a 10-minute video recording of parent-child playtime, which will be used to study parenting behavior.

Eligibility Criteria

Eligible

You may qualify if you...

  • Child aged between 6 months (corrected for prematurity) and 5 years
  • Documented developmental delay and/or socio-communicative difficulties based on clinical signs or standardized scales
  • Child has a mental age of at least 6 months
  • Diagnosis of neurodevelopmental disability including cerebral palsy, genetic syndromes, rare diseases with non-progressive neurological impairments, or congenital disorders
  • Parent is an adult aged 18 years or older
  • Parent has good knowledge and fluency in Italian
  • Parent has no manifest psychiatric conditions
  • Parent has no documented intellectual disability
Not Eligible

You will not qualify if you...

  • Child older than 5 years at recruitment
  • Child with mental age below 6 months
  • Child without developmental delay (developmental quotient above 85) and no socio-communicative difficulties
  • Child diagnosed with neurodegenerative diseases or brain tumor outcomes
  • Child with severe sensory impairments such as profound deafness or blindness
  • Parent unable to speak Italian
  • Parent with documented psychiatric conditions or intellectual disability
